YEAR 2012

ST Marine’s US operations, VT Halter Marine, had delivered the 112’ ATB offshore tug, Evening Star, for Bouchard Transportation Co., Inc. (Bouchard).

ST Marine injected additional capital into its associated company, Fortis Marine Solutions Pte Ltd. The capital injection will allow Fortis Marine Solutions to be fully operational.

ST Marine’s US operations, VT Halter Marine, had announced a partnership agreement with DCNS to submit a proposal to the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) for the design and construction of the U.S. Coast Guard (USCG) offshore patrol cutter (OPC). The USCG anticipates to acquire as many as 25 OPCs to replace its existing fleet of 28 vessels built between1964 to 1991.

ST Marine sector was awarded S$179m worth of shipbuilding and repair contracts, which includes, a contract to build two additional offshore support vessels (OSVs) for Hornbeck Offshore Services, LLC; and a series of repairs and upgrading contracts to various types of OSVs such as drillship, dredgers and rig.

ST Marine’s US operations, VT Halter Marine, has become a member of the IMAGE program with U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E). The ICE Mutual Agreement between Government and Employers (IMAGE) provides businesses an opportunity to partner with the agency to develop a more secure and stable workforce.

ST Marine was awarded a shipbuilding contract worth about S$880m from the Royal Navy of Oman, to design and build four patrol vessels. The project will commence immediately with the first vessel expected to be delivered in 2Q2015 and the final vessel in 3Q2016.

ST Marine has partnered with Swedish Kockums AB, to form a joint venture called Fortis Marine Solutions Pte. Ltd. with the primary objective of providing a higher level in-country capability in the refitting and life cycle support services for the submarine fleet.

ST Marine delivered the 141m Landing Platform Dock (LPD), which it designed and built for the Royal Thai Navy. The design of the LPD is proprietary to ST Marine and is based on its Endurance Class of LPDs.

ST Marine was awarded additional shipbuilding contract worth S$75m, from Swire Pacific Offshore Operations (Pte) Ltd (SPO), a wholly owned subsidiary of Swire Pacific Limited to build two additional offshore supply vessels.

YEAR 2011

ST Marine was awarded a shipbuilding contract worth about S$171m from Swire Pacific Offshore Operations (Pte) Ltd (SPO), a wholly owned subsidiary of Swire Pacific Limited to build and outfit four Anchor Handling Tug Supply (AHTS) vessels.

ST Marine's US operations, VT Halter Marine, was awarded a contract to build a 112-foot ATB Offshore Tug for Bouchard Transportation Co., Inc. (Bouchard).

ST Marine secured a contract by Garuda Energy to convert a decommissioned jack-up rig into a Mobile Offshore Production Unit (MOPU).

ST Marine won a conversion contract by Trinity Offshore Pte Ltd to convert the accommodation vessel Trinity Supporter to a multi-purpose offshore vessel.

ST Marine was awarded a contract from Van Oord ACZ to upgrade its Trailing Suction Hopper Dredger, Volvox Terranova.

ST Marine was contracted by Saipem (Portugal) Comercio Maritimo (Saipem) to provide additional upgrading work for its semi-submersible pipe-laying vessel, SEMAC 1.

ST Marine's US operations, VT Halter Marine, was awarded a contract to build a second Roll-On/Roll-Off Car Truck Carrier from Honolulu-based Pasha Hawaii (Pasha).

YEAR 2010

ST Marine's environmental arm, STSE Engineering Services Pte Ltd (STSE) incorporated a wholly owned subsidiary, STSE Engineering Services (B) Sdn Bhd (STSEB), in Brunei. 

ST Marine's environmental arm, STSE Engineering Services, secured a contract to provide a proprietary loop-based Pneumatic Waste Collection System (PWCS) to collect recyclables, non-recyclables and food waste iin Tianjin's Eco-City's Eco-Business Park.

ST Marine's environmental arm, STSE Engineering Services, secured a contract to design and construct a modern Integrated Waste Management Facility in Brunei – its largest environmental engineering projects to date.

ST Marine's US operations, VT Halter Marine, was awarded a contract by the US Navy to build a 4th Fast Missile Craft for the Egyptian Navy.

ST Marine signed JV agreement with Hovertransport Consultants Ltd and Clearstone Investments LLC to form subsidiary, Hovertrans Solutions Pte Ltd.

YEAR 2009

ST Marine' environmental arm, STSE Engineering Services, was awarded a tender for the design, build and delivery of a Waste Transfer Station in Donghu Newtech Zone in Wuhan, China.

ST Marine secured contract for the logistics management of the RSN's warehouses at its Changi and Tuas Naval Bases.

ST Marine's US operations, VT Halter Marine, was awarded by OSG Ship Management Inc. to undertake the outfitting and commissioning of two 350,000 barrel articulated tug barge unit (ATB).

ST Marine won its first ShipPax Award 2009 in the RoRo concept category for RoRo vessel, "City of Hamburg".

ST Marine delivered its second RoRo.

ST Marine's first Submarine Support & Rescue Vessel commenced service for RSN.

ST Marine's environmental arm, STSE Engineering Services secured contract to design, build and deliver Materials Recovery Facility in Beijing, China.

YEAR 2008

ST Marine secured a contract to design and build a seismic survey vessel.

ST Marine secured a contract to design and building Landing Platform Dock.

ST Marine won a contract to build and outfit a diving support vessel.

ST Marine set up wholly-owned subsidiary in China to focus on environmental engineering.

ST Marine signed JV Agreement with James Fisher Marine Services for submarine rescue contract.

ST Marine secured a contract to lengthen Australian derrick pipelay barge.

ST Marine awarded anchor handling tug supply vessel contract.

ST Marine launched and delivered first RoRo - first in Singapore's history

ST Marine secured contract for outfitting works on seismic research vessel.  

YEAR 2007

ST Marine awarded submarine rescue contract by RSN.

ST Marine delivered the first container vessel for Transworld Group.

ST Marine launched the third container vessel for Transworld Group.

ST Marine secured a contract to build Ropax Ferry for Louis Dreyfus Armateurs.  

YEAR 2006

ST Marine secured contract to convert a platform supply vessel to a seismic research vessel.

ST Marine launched the first container vessel for Transworld Group.

ST Marine delivered the first locally-built "RSS Intrepid" to RSN.

ST Marine won contract to modify cutter suction dredger.

ST Marine secured contract to convert fishing trawler to a seismic research vessel.

ST Marine won contracts to build vessels for transporting Airbus aircraft components.

YEAR 2005

ST Marine launched second, third and fourth locally-built frigate for RSN.

ST Marine secured contracts to design and built four feeder container vessels for Transworld Group.  

YEAR 2004

ST Marine launched first locally-built frigate for RSN.

ST Marine secured contract to design and built a Landing Supply Craft for Kuwait's Ministry of Interior.  

YEAR 2002

ST Marine began RSN Frigate newbuilding programme.

ST Marine acquired shipbuilding facilities in the US, renamed VT Halter Marine.

ST Marine completed upgrading programme of its Benoi Yard.

YEAR 1997

ST Marine secured contract to construct three Platform Supply Vessels for Tidewater Inc.

ST Marine merged with ST Aerospace, ST Electronics and ST Auto (renamed ST Kinetics) to form ST Engineering Limited.  

YEAR 1996

ST Marine secured contract to design and construct four Landing Ship Tanks for the RSN.  

YEAR 1994

ST Marine started Tuas Yard operations.

ST Marine secured contract to design and build two units of 1018 TEU feeder container vessels for Regional Container Lines (RCL).  

YEAR 1993

ST Marine secured contract to design and construct 12 Patrol Vessels for the RSN.  

YEAR 1991

ST Marine secured contract to outfit three Mine Counter Measure Vessels for the RSN.

ST Marine secured contract to design and build two RoRo/LoLo feeder container vessels for Tropical Shipping, USA.  

YEAR 1990

ST Marine is listed publicly.  

YEAR 1988

ST Marine delivered first of six Missile Corvettes to the RSN.  

YEAR 1986

ST Marine signed Industrial Prime Vendor (IPV) Contract with Indian Coast Guard.  

YEAR 1979

ST Marine built the first of 12 Coastal Patrol Craft for the RSN.  

YEAR 1977

Singapore Technologies (formerly Sheng-Li Holdings) took a majority stake in ST Marine.  

YEAR 1972

ST Marine delivered Missile Gun Boats to the RSN.  

YEAR 1969

ST Marine signed Technical Co-operation Agreement with Lurssen Werft to build Missile Gun Boats for the Republic of Singapore Navy (RSN).  

YEAR 1968

ST Marine was incorporated.
